How they compare
Haiti currently reports 35,118 TJ against 28,926 TJ in OECD, a difference of 6,192 TJ.
That makes Haiti's figure about 1.2 times OECD's.
The two have swapped places 1 time across 35 shared years of data; in 1990 it was OECD ahead.
Haiti ranks 21st and OECD ranks 24th of 162 countries.
Across the 4 decades both report, Haiti averaged higher in 2 and OECD in 2.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Haiti | OECD |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1990s | 23,001 TJ | 31,048 TJ | 8,047 TJ | OECD |
| 2000s | 28,488 TJ | 37,710 TJ | 9,221 TJ | OECD |
| 2010s | 37,060 TJ | 36,896 TJ | 164.17 TJ | Haiti |
| 2020s | 36,496 TJ | 29,920 TJ | 6,576 TJ | Haiti |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.

About this data
The FAOSTAT domain Bioenergy contains data on bioenergy use and bioenergy production, covering the following items: i) animal waste, ii) bagasse, iii) bio jet kerosene, iv) biodiesel, v) biogases, vi) biogasoline, vii) black liquor, viii) charcoal, ix) fuelwood, x) other liquid biofuels, xi) other vegetal material and residues.
